Upregulated long non-coding RNA AGAP2-AS1 represses LATS2 and KLF2 expression through interacting with EZH2 and LSD1 in non-small-cell lung cancer cells

摘要
Recently, long non-coding RNAs (lncRNAs) are identified as new crucial regulators of diverse cellular processes, including cell proliferation, differentiation and cancer cells metastasis. Accumulating evidence has revealed that aberrant lncRNA expression plays important roles in carcinogenesis and tumor progression. However, the expression pattern and biological function of lncRNAs in non-small-cell lung cancer (NSCLC) remain largely unknown. In this study, we performed comprehensive analysis of lncRNA expression in human NSCLC samples by using microarray data from Gene Expression Omnibus. After validation in a cohort of 80 pairs of NSCLC tissues, we identified a differentially expressed novel oncogenic lncRNA termed as AGAP2-AS1. The AGAP2-AS1 expression level was significantly upregulated in NSCLC tissues and negatively correlated with poor prognostic outcomes in patients. In vitro loss-and gain-of-function assays revealed that AGAP2-AS1 knockdown inhibited cell proliferation, migration and invasion, and induced cell apoptosis. In vivo assays also confirmed the ability of AGAP2-AS1 to promote tumor growth. Furthermore, mechanistic investigation showed that AGAP2-AS1 could bind with enhancer of zeste homolog 2 and lysine (K)-specific demethylase 1A, and recruit them to KLF2 and LATS2 promoter regions to repress their transcription. Taken together, our findings indicate that AGAP2-AS1 may act as an oncogene by repressing tumor-suppressor LATS2 and KLF2 transcription. By clarifying the AGAP2-AS1 mechanisms underlying NSCLC development and progression, these findings might promote the development of novel therapeutic strategies for this disease.
